Driving up North
I drove in the worse weather I have ever driven today. We received over 1 1/2 feet of snow and almost all roads were unplowed (even the highways). That meant, if I ever stopped the car, it was almost impossible of getting it moving again. I ran through many stoplihts (no cars in the other direction), but thats okay as snow was covering m license plate. I drove from Boston to Portland in 4 1/2 hours ( a trip that normally takes about 1 1/2), and saw probabily 75 accidents/cars stuck in snow. It was really bad as the visiability was about 15 feet with the wind. At some points in the highway I could even see a car I was passing. It made it really creepy for driving as out of the blue a car would appear and be within 10 feet of you. Below is a picture out my windsheild when a trcuk was about 20 feet away from me. You can barely make out its lights. Pretty creepy driving.

I stopped in Portland with Renee and Jeff as I didnt feel like braving the remaining 45 miles of unplowed highway at 20 MPH. They, being the gracious host as always, took me in and wined and dined me. It sounds as if Jeff may be taking his company private (it was owned by MEDCO earlier). Overall, it would have been much better to wai out this storm in Boston, as my sister told me too. But what kind of younger brother would I be if I listened to her?
